Output e80a1bd58a05ff987628188238efb6dc462bacf72200ca981b1acd1d3ed76fc8:7

value
23649
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1bf6754b8d2d46e5a7db5b3b1e95506481f6b2cb60f59506796eb0f7deab2714
address
bc1pr0m82jud94rwtf7mtva3a92svjqldvktvr6e2pned6c00h4tyu2qv3u6j2
transaction
e80a1bd58a05ff987628188238efb6dc462bacf72200ca981b1acd1d3ed76fc8
spent
true